Investigation of the Categorical Structure of Perception of Musical Fragments, Transformed with the Help of Contemporary Acoustic Technologies

Abstract

This article presents experimental data which demonstrates that along with the tempo-rhythmic, harmonic and melodic structure of a musical composition, the means of recording, , the technical conditions for the transfer of sound, has as strong an influence. Data obtained from the results of semantic scaling of musical fragments, characterized by different recording formats, testify differences in the categorical structure of their perception. At the same time, as a result of wide dissemination of recordings of musical works in the format МP3 and preferential listening to music, transmitted through the electro-acoustic channels and via the Internet rather than in natural conditions, it appears that preference is given to that recording format, despite the evidence of its low quality. The question arises about the negative impact on the perception of such a change in the acoustic environment, in particular, about changes in the auditory standards, developed in humans during evolution. It is also feared that an increase of the popularity of synthetic music, which on the one hand, opens up new possibilities of perception of sound material by humans, but on the other - from the perspective of psychology of perception, has been poorly studied.
